Working during the holidays? Here are 5 tips to boost your productivity

With schedules lightened up, you can get yourself organized for the new year 

The holidays may feel a little different this year, but nonetheless, the holiday season presents a great opportunity to recharge the batteries and set yourself up for a great new year.  

Many use the holidays as a chance to take some time off work and come in fresh for the new year. However, some prefer to use the season as a chance to get some quality work done. With more peers taking time off, this presents a good opportunity to focus on forgotten tasks, lingering assignments and most of all, taking the opportunity to plan and strategize for the new year.  

At the same time, even if you are working through much of the holidays, it’s important to use any extra days off you do have (Christmas, New Year’s Day, etc…) to relax and come in refreshed for the new year. After all, a break, both mentally and physically, will do you a world of good and ultimately make you more productive when you are back at the office. 

If you are indeed planning on working through the holidays, here are some tips to keep you productive, while at the same time, making sure you’re refreshed for the new year. 

1. Separate personal life and work 

While this is somewhat of a year-round tip, it carries extra weight over the holidays, given that others in your household may have time off as well, be it your spouse from work or kids being home from school. Whether you choose to go into the office a few days or work from home, it’s important to have a proper workspace. You want to avoid any potential distractions that could occur due to working in a common area like your dining room table or living room. 

Instead use a spare room or divide your workspace accordingly. Having personal distractions around will only hurt your chances of being productive. Conversely, you don’t want your mind constantly on work during your off hours. 

2. Set mini goals for yourself… and rewards 

Setting daily goals is a solid practice to gauge how productive your days are and how much you’re able to accomplish. This also helps motivate you throughout the day, as you can end your workday feeling good about completing the goals you’ve set out to do.  

This is also a good way to offer yourself potential ‘rewards’ for reaching your goals. It could be something as simple as spending some time with your kids after completing an accounting report, having a nice snack after a successful meeting or taking a 15-minute power nap to get yourself re-energized. 

3. Schedule time off – and stick to it 

If you’re working throughout the holidays, there still are some days where the office will be closed. While staying tuned in for anything urgent is important, it’s equally important to use the time off to your advantage.  

Having the extra time to recharge the batteries and spend some quality time with those around you will do a world of good for your mental well-being and will make you more productive when you are at work.  

4. Use the extra time to plan for the new year 

With many colleagues taking time off for the holidays, this could be a great opportunity to focus on your personal goals for the new year. How can you stay better organized? How can you better plan out your daily tasks? What goals do you want to accomplish for you (and possibly your team) in 2021?  

Given that yearly evaluations will take place sometime before the end of the year, it’s a perfect time to reflect on your performance and find ways to start the new year off on the right foot. 

5. Focus on tasks you’ve been putting off 

It can easily happen to any of us. You want to fulfill every task that comes across your desk, but certain tasks have to be prioritized over others at times. Before you know it, you have several tasks piled up that you meant to complete weeks, or even months ago, sitting on your to-do list. 

With things being a little quieter around the holidays, it’s a perfect time to tackle those lingering tasks and put a neat little bow on your calendar year.
